Transaction 03dbbabf58210a36d67acd4bde2807c57e043c1f5a671492b54b196935f0b481
1 Input
1 Output
-
03dbbabf58210a36d67acd4bde2807c57e043c1f5a671492b54b196935f0b481:0
- value
- 38003
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8a4bd2ea1973b29304cfc040451dd48bc81e3293 OP_EQUAL
- address
- 3EJG1MP6T8skG4foTcGfiZX1gAKnvARUJB